摘要
随着现代信息与通信技术(ICT)的快速发展,人类活动—移动模式正在经历着深刻的变革,这些变革可能会给人们的日常生活以及人类的空间组织带来重大影响。时间地理学提供了一个非常有用的理论研究框架,它不仅可以表达连续时空背景下人类活动受到的各种制约条件,而且能够解析物质空间和虚拟空间中人类活动与互动的复杂时空关系。然而,经典的时间地理学方法并不支持ICT影响下的人类活动与互动行为研究。基于此,本文首先对经典时间地理学中的相关概念进行扩展,使其能够满足物质—虚拟混合空间(AHybrid Physical-virtual Space)中人类活动与互动的研究需要。然后,本文发展了一套时空地理信息系统(Space-time GIS)体系结构,它能支持在时空背景下将复杂的人类活动与互动数据作为连续的时空过程进行组织与管理,同时它还为研究人员提供了一个有益的分析环境,从时空一体化的角度研究现代社会动态发展过程中的人类活动—移动模式与交通需求模式及其相互影响。
Modern information and communication technologies (ICT) are changing human activity and travel patterns that could have significant implications to our everyday lives and the human organization of space.Time geography,which examines human activities under various constraints in a space-time context,provides a useful framework to analyze the complex spatio-temporal relationships among activities and interactions taking place in both physical and virtual spaces.However,virtual activities and interactions conducted via ICT have characteristics that cannot be properly represented and analyzed under the classical time-geographic framework.This paper extends classical time-geographic concepts to accommodate the needs of representing and analyzing all activities and interactions in a hybrid physical-virtual space.In addition,this paper presents a space-time geographic information system (GIS) design that is capable of organizing complex activity and interaction data as spatio-temporal processes in an integrated space-time environment.This space-time GIS design offers a useful analytical environment for researchers to study increasingly dynamic human activity and travel patterns in today’s society and their implications toward changing travel demand patterns from both spatial and temporal perspectives.
